I found the following banks in the following countries to be very fast:


- Panama


- Cyprus


- St.Vincent


- Mauritius


In average it took me aprox 2 weeks to get the bank account opened and another 5 - 7 days (depending on where the parcel comes from) to receive my PIN's, tokens and all this stuff, and yes, my Debit Cards :) I'm the happy owner of 7 Visa and MasterCard debit Cards at the moment.
